Tottenham transfer news: Vincent Janssen undergoes medical ahead of expected £18.8m move to Spurs

The London club are on the verge of finalising a deal with Dutch side AK Alkmaar for the forward

Vincent Janssen is poised to complete his move from AK Alkmaar to Tottenham Hotspur as the Dutch forward undergoes a medical with the London club, according to reports.

After spending two weeks thrashing out an agreement for the forward – in which an original £15m was rejected by the Eredivisie side – it’s understood that a deal worth to be £18.8m has finally been settled upon.

The 22-year-old made 34 appearances for AZ Alkmaar last season, scoring 25 goals, and is expected to provide attacking cover to Harry Kane.

In light of Mauricio Pochettino’s favoured 4-2-3-1 formation, in which Kane has nailed down his position at the spearhead of Tottenham’s attack, it’s likely the Dutch striker will join the side as a squad player.

However, Janssen has insisted he’ll be more than just back-up. “Harry Kane? People can say what they want but I'm not afraid of anybody,” he said.

“He is a great striker but we will see how it goes. We can complement each other, I think I can learn a lot from him.”

The Holland international is reported to have flown to London on Monday in order to undergo his medical and is expected to remain in the capital until Tuesday to finalise the deal.

Janssen had originally visited Spurs’ training ground over a month ago after being given permission by Alkmaar.

According to Sky Sports, the player has been on Tottenham’s books since last May when Pochettino and head of recruitment Paul Mitchell spotted the Dutchman in a friendly match against Republic of Ireland.

Both Wolfsburg and Paris Saint-Germain reportedly had their own offers for the striker rejected but cooled their interest once the striker expressed his desire to move to Spurs.

Alkmaar are poised to make a healthy profit from Janssen having bought the player from Almere last summer in a deal reported to be worth €400,000.
